_Note: Gaps between patch versions are faulty/broken releases._
## 3.0.10
* **Bug Fix**
* In `types.getIds` make sure the `declaration` inside of `ExportDeclaration` is actually a `Declaration`.
## 3.0.9
* **Bug Fix**
* Make `t.isReferenced` more powerful, actually take into consideration all contexts were identifier nodes aren't actually references.
* Don't camelcase underscores when converting a string to a valid identifier.

"use strict";
// in this transformer we have to split up classes and function declarations
// from their exports. why? because sometimes we need to replace classes with
// nodes that aren't allowed in the same contexts. also, if you're exporting
// a generator function as a default then regenerator will destroy the export
// declaration and leave a variable declaration in it's place... yeah, handy.
